AN ACT
|
|
relating to declination, cancellation, or nonrenewal of insurance |
|
policies. |
|
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
|
SECTION 1. Section 551.001(a), Insurance Code, is amended |
|
to read as follows: |
|
(a) The commissioner may, as necessary, adopt and enforce |
|
reasonable rules, including notice requirements, relating to the |
|
declination of a completed and submitted application for or the |
|
cancellation or [and] nonrenewal of any insurance policy regulated |
|
by the department under: |
|
(1) Chapter 5; |
|
(2) Chapter 1804, 1805, 2171, or 2301; or |
|
(3) Subtitle C, D, E, or F, Title 10. |
|
SECTION 2. Section 551.002(a), Insurance Code, is amended |
|
to read as follows: |
|
(a) The commissioner shall require an insurer that declines |
|
a completed and submitted application for or cancels or refuses to |
|
renew an insurance policy to which Section 551.001 applies[, on |
|
request by an applicant for insurance or a policyholder,] to |
|
provide to the applicant or policyholder or the applicant's agent |
|
in accordance with Section 551.007, as applicable, a written |
|
statement of the reasons for the declination, cancellation, or |
|
nonrenewal of the [an insurance] policy [to which Section 551.001 |
|
applies]. |
|
SECTION 3. Subchapter A, Chapter 551, Insurance Code, is |
|
amended by adding Sections 551.006, 551.007, and 551.008 to read as |
|
follows: |
|
Sec. 551.006. REPORT REQUIRED. (a) An insurer shall |
|
provide to the department at least once each quarter a written |
|
report summarizing the insurer's reasons for declination, |
|
cancellation, or nonrenewal provided to applicants for insurance or |
|
policyholders as required by this chapter. The report must be: |
|
(1) in the form and manner prescribed by the |
|
commissioner; and |
|
(2) except as provided by Subsection (c), organized by |
|
the zip codes of the applicants and policyholders, as applicable, |
|
that received the statement. |
|
(b) The department shall post an aggregated summary of the |
|
reports provided under this section on the department's Internet |
|
website. The aggregated summary: |
|
(1) except as provided by Subsection (c), must be |
|
organized by the zip codes of the applicants and policyholders, as |
|
applicable; and |
|
(2) may not identify, directly or indirectly, any |
|
insurer. |
|
(c) A report under this section summarizing reasons for |
|
declination, cancellation, or nonrenewal provided to applicants |
|
for or policyholders of workers' compensation insurance policies |
|
must be a statewide report and not organized by the zip codes of the |
|
applicants or policyholders. |
|
Sec. 551.007. NOTICE OF DECLINATION FOR COMMERCIAL LINES OF |
|
INSURANCE. (a) An insurer must deliver a notice of a declination |
|
required by this chapter for a completed and submitted application |
|
for a commercial line of insurance to the applicant's agent. |
|
(b) On receiving a notice described by Subsection (a), an |
|
agent shall disclose the declination to the applicant and make the |
|
notice available for the applicant to review. |
|
Sec. 551.008. ELECTRONIC DELIVERY. An insurer may deliver |
|
notice or a written statement of a declination, cancellation, or |
|
nonrenewal required by this chapter electronically in accordance |
|
with Chapter 35. |
|
SECTION 4. The heading to Subchapter B, Chapter 551, |
|
Insurance Code, is amended to read as follows: |
|
SUBCHAPTER B. DECLINATION, CANCELLATION, AND NONRENEWAL OF CERTAIN |
|
LIABILITY AND COMMERCIAL PROPERTY INSURANCE POLICIES |
|
SECTION 5. Subchapter B, Chapter 551, Insurance Code, is |
|
amended by adding Section 551.0521 to read as follows: |
|
Sec. 551.0521. WRITTEN NOTICE OF DECLINATION REQUIRED. An |
|
insurer that declines a completed and submitted application for a |
|
liability insurance or commercial property insurance policy shall |
|
deliver or mail written notice of the declination to the applicant |
|
or the applicant's agent in accordance with Section 551.007, as |
|
applicable. |
|
SECTION 6. Section 551.055, Insurance Code, is amended to |
|
read as follows: |
|
Sec. 551.055. REASON FOR DECLINATION, CANCELLATION, OR |
|
NONRENEWAL REQUIRED. In a notice to an applicant or insured |
|
relating to declination, cancellation, or refusal to renew, an |
|
insurer must state the reason for the declination, cancellation, or |
|
nonrenewal. The statement must comply with: |
|
(1) Sections 551.002(b) and (c); and |
|
(2) rules adopted under Section 551.002(d). |
|
SECTION 7. Section 551.109, Insurance Code, is amended to |
|
read as follows: |
|
Sec. 551.109. INSURER STATEMENT. An insurer shall[, at the |
|
request of an applicant for insurance or an insured,] provide a |
|
written statement of the reason for a declination of a completed and |
|
submitted application for an insurance policy or a[,] |
|
cancellation[,] or nonrenewal of an insurance policy. The |
|
statement must comply with: |
|
(1) Sections 551.002(b) and (c); and |
|
(2) rules adopted under Section 551.002(d). |
|
SECTION 8. The change in law made by this Act applies only |
|
to an application for insurance that is made or an insurance policy |
|
that is delivered, issued for delivery, or renewed on or after the |
|
effective date of this Act. An application made or policy |
|
delivered, issued for delivery, or renewed before the effective |
|
date of this Act is governed by the law as it existed immediately |
|
before the effective date of this Act, and that law is continued in |
|
effect for that purpose. |
|
SECTION 9. This Act takes effect January 1, 2026. |

I certify that H.B. No. 2067 was passed by the House on April |
|
25, 2025, by the following vote: Yeas 123, Nays 2, 1 present, not |
|
voting; that the House refused to concur in Senate amendments to |
|
H.B. No. 2067 on May 29, 2025, and requested the appointment of a |
|
conference committee to consider the differences between the two |
|
houses; and that the House adopted the conference committee report |
|
on H.B. No. 2067 on May 31, 2025, by the following vote: Yeas 128, |
|
Nays 0, 2 present, not voting. |
|
|
|
______________________________ |
|
Chief Clerk of the House |
|
|
I certify that H.B. No. 2067 was passed by the Senate, with |
|
amendments, on May 25, 2025, by the following vote: Yeas 31, Nays |
|
0; at the request of the House, the Senate appointed a conference |
|
committee to consider the differences between the two houses; and |
|
that the Senate adopted the conference committee report on H.B. No. |
|
2067 on May 31, 2025, by the following vote: Yeas 31, Nays 0. |
